Project bid evaluation is the process of selecting contractors with high engineering level and management standard,low price,abundant funds,and who have best credit in performance and qualification.This paper studies and implements an engineering bid evaluation system based on matter-element extension theory in order that people can give scientific and reasonable assessment results while they consider the situation of contractors in technical management,financial economy and qualification credit.Being based on the analysis of existing evaluation methods at domestic and overseas,combined the basic theory with method of project evaluation firstly.And then introduced the basic concept of basing on matter-element extension model.After that the paper determined the classical domain and joint domain,identified for the evaluation of matter-element,calculation for evaluation of the matter-element.This engineering project evaluation is established for the bidder evaluation index system,which includes the technical management of the tendering units,commercial economy,qualification,these three subsystems,and also 15 indicators establishes a theoretical foundation for the design of the evaluation system.Next,carrying on the demand analysis,outline design and detailed design of the bid evaluation system according to the software engineering theory.Finally,a standalone version based on C++ platform,MySQL database is achieved.The based on matter-element extension engineering project bid evaluation system possesses six function modules of login management,project information maintenance,evaluation committee expert management,bidder management,bid evaluation calculation,current project information maintenance.The test results of the system module structure and overall function show that the system runs stably and can accurately calculate the grade of the contractor’s comprehensive strength. |
